British National obtaining Indian CPL

Can a British National obtain an Indian CPL (H)? Currently flying with a JAA CPL (H) on FATA in India - love the country and want to stay! Been informed verbally from DGCA that it would not be a problem but would appreciate comments from those that know.

Obviously subject to flying requirements and passing air regs + composite papers.
